What Working Capital Loans Are and Why Utica Businesses Use Them

Working capital loans deliver short-term liquidity when revenue timing doesn't match expense schedules. Unlike term loans tied to a specific asset, these funds cover operating costs: raw materials for a machine shop on Schoenherr, payroll during a slow quarter, or bridge financing while waiting on receivables. Utica's mix of automotive suppliers, small manufacturers, and retail storefronts often face inventory swings tied to OEM production cycles, making flexible working capital a practical tool for smoothing cash flow without disrupting operations.

A Realistic Utica Scenario

A family-owned tool-and-die shop near the intersection of Van Dyke and Hall Road receives a large contract requiring immediate material purchases. Revenue won't arrive for sixty days, but suppliers expect payment on delivery. A working capital advance bridges the gap, letting the shop fulfill the order without stalling production or turning away future work. How quickly can a Utica business receive working capital funds?+
Once documentation is complete and underwriting approves the file, many lenders disburse working capital within three to seven business days. Timeline depends on bank-statement quality, completeness of your application, and the lender's current queue, not on promises a broker cannot control.
Do working capital loans require collateral or a specific credit score?+
Many working capital products rely on cash-flow analysis rather than hard collateral, though some lenders may file a blanket UCC lien. Credit matters, but consistent revenue and healthy bank statements often carry more weight than a single score in the underwriter's decision matrix.
Can seasonal businesses along Van Dyke qualify for working capital?+
Yes. Seasonal patterns are common in Utica's manufacturing and retail sectors. Underwriters look for predictable cycles, prior-year comparisons, and a plan showing how the advance will be repaid when revenue returns. Documentation and narrative clarity make or break seasonal applications.
